STM-3
The STM-3 is a surface station designed to save space yet still offer all the tracking abilities you would need. It has a splash-proof housing so that it can be used where wet weather is expected. Also, it has internal batteries, that will last on average 6 hours, with an external power hookup. The STM-3 also comes with 15 meter sonar transducer cables. This configuration has a nominal range of 500 meters.
STM-3V
This verison of the STM-3 has the exact same as the standard version. However, pict ure annotation is available through an RC Jack on the STM-3V. It has a built-in frame grabber; thus, allowing this unit to run all its accessories off one single cable to the PC.
STM-3H
The STM-3H is a surface station designed to have a longer internal battery life as well as extended range. This surface station has everything that the STM-3 has with additional hardware. The STM-3H has the high-powered module, which extends its nominal range to 1000 meters. It also has a longer internal battery life, which on average is 12 hours. The sonar transducer cables are 30 meters. It, too, has the RC JACK for picture annotation. The STM-3H is just over twice as big as the STM-3, but theN the STM-3 is quite small to begin with.
